Understanding Refractive Surgical Procedure Procedures



When taking into consideration refractive surgery procedures, it's essential to recognize exactly how they can improve your vision.

These techniques concentrate on fixing usual vision concerns like nearsightedness, hyperopia, and astigmatism. You'll commonly run into methods such as LASIK, PRK, and SMILE, each making use of advanced modern technology to alter the shape of your cornea.

LASIK includes producing a flap in the cornea, while PRK eliminates the outer layer totally. SMILE, on the other hand, utilizes a minimally invasive strategy.

Before dedicating, you'll undergo a thorough evaluation to figure out the very best alternative for your eyes. Comprehending these treatments provides you the expertise to make an informed decision, guaranteeing you select the best path towards more clear vision tailored to your distinct requirements.

Benefits and Dangers of Refractive Surgical Procedure



While refractive surgery can use life-altering benefits, it's necessary to evaluate these versus the potential dangers entailed. Lots of people experience enhanced vision, minimized reliance on glasses or call lenses, and improved quality of life. You could locate everyday tasks, like driving or working out, much easier without visual help.

However, dangers such as dry eyes, glow, halos, or perhaps vision loss can take place. It's important to have reasonable assumptions and understand that outcomes can differ. Not every person is an ideal candidate, and pre-existing conditions can make complex results.
